In a recent plenary session, Nikos Christodoulides, the President of Cyprus, outlined the nation’s presidency priorities for the European Union, emphasizing the vision of an “Autonomous Union. Open to the World.” This declaration comes at a time marked by significant global challenges, including geopolitical instability and the ongoing impacts of the digital and environmental transitions. European Parliament President Roberta Metsola welcomed President Christodoulides, noting the critical period for both Europe and the broader international community. Metsola reinforced the commitment to maintaining Europe’s competitiveness and focus on security and defense, aiming to ensure a strong European presence on the global stage. She endorsed the support for Cyprus in its efforts towards becoming a bicommunal, bizonal federation, aligning with UN resolutions and EU law. President Christodoulides highlighted several key areas during his address. He stressed the importance of European unity and deeper integration to effectively respond to international pressures such as the war in Ukraine and the necessity for enhanced security architectures. The Cyprus Presidency aims to foster a pragmatic approach towards competitiveness, focusing on investment, innovation, and support for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s). Christodoulides also called for progress in EU enlargement, describing it as a crucial geopolitical tool, and emphasized the importance of strong relationships with regions such as the Southern Neighbourhood, the Gulf, and notable global partners like the United States and the United Kingdom. The session also saw various Members of the European Parliament expressing their support for the priorities set by the Cyprus Presidency, particularly in aspects of European autonomy, security, and the need for a resilient and decisive Europe in a complex geopolitical environment. The discussion further covered the significance of addressing migration issues, enhancing social cohesion, and ensuring the rule of law and democratic values within the EU.
